Understanding the Cost of Borrowing Calculator
The Cost of Borrowing Calculator is a valuable financial planning tool designed for individuals who want to evaluate the true cost of their credit purchases. This calculator provides insights into how credit impacts financial decisions by calculating total costs, including interest and minimum payments.
By understanding the cost of borrowing, users can make informed choices about their credit card usage and overall financial health.

Completing the Cost of Borrowing Calculator: Field-by-Field Instructions
When filling out the Cost of Borrowing Calculator, pay attention to the following fields:
-
Purchase Amount: The total price of the item you wish to finance.
-
Annual Interest Rate: The percentage rate your credit provider charges for borrowing.
-
Minimum Payment: The least amount you must pay monthly to avoid penalties.
Common mistakes to avoid include miscalculating the interest rate or misinterpreting the minimum payment requirements.
